Sydney Roosters captain James Tedesco and veteran prop Jared Waerea-Hargreaves have been charged over incidents in Thursday night's gripping 18-12 loss to the Storm.

Tedesco was charged with dangerous contact after tripping rival fullback Ryan Papenhuyzen in the 71st minute of the match at Allianz Stadium and faces a fine of $750 if he pleads guilty or $1000 if he unsuccessfully challenges the charge.

Waerea-Hargreaves was also charged with dangerous contact for an incident involving Melbourne prop Christian Welch in the eighth minute and is looking at a fine of $1800 or $2500 for his second offence.

Meanwhile, Dolphins five-eighth Anthony Milford, Sea Eagles forward Josh Aloiai and Sharks winger Sione Katoa have all been suspended after entering early guilty pleas to charges arising from Round 6.

Milford will be sidelined for two matches after a Grade 2 Dangerous Contact offence involving Broncos fullback Reece Walsh while Aloiai and Katoa will each miss one match.

Aloiai entered an early guilty plea to a Grade 2 Dangerous Contact charge on Warriors halfback Shaun Johnson and will miss Manly's Round 7 clash against the Titans.

Katoa was charged with a Grade 2 Careless High Tackle for his contact on Souths captain Cameron Murray in the closing minute of the first half at Accor Stadium on Saturday night. He will miss Cronulla's game against the Cowboys.
